Transaction 2139aa89def21101b52094d6f00ff0af4c7917d66cb901e8fa090ebf3e2a714d

1 Input
2 Outputs
  • 2139aa89def21101b52094d6f00ff0af4c7917d66cb901e8fa090ebf3e2a714d:0
  • value  343513883
    address  3JdUEhxeQ8ft84GYudqqxi8pYjiyBJHQen
  • 2139aa89def21101b52094d6f00ff0af4c7917d66cb901e8fa090ebf3e2a714d:1
  • value  850085
    address  1Pk6zV326kgrbbNCygFnnvfFiq2rHYpaQg